Make your own way to the visitor centre - Not worth the money. Make your own way there to the visitor centre for the informative talk by the guide from the visitor centre. There’s not much to the tour at all. If you can go to the salt pans at Marsala it’s worth it because they have a much better visitor centre and there’s the nearby Phoenician island of Mozia to visit. It’s really close and there are constant trips out by small boat ever day. We had been told that our group was the only group that was on the Trapani salt pan tour but there were several other groups on the mini bus when we got picked up and also at the visitor centre talk too. This wasn’t a big problem but was not as advertised.
